How To Fix IR504 - Measuring point &1 is not available; it is a reference measuring point


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: IR - PM: IMRC - Measurement Readings and Counters

  • Message number: 504

  • Message text: Measuring point &1 is not available; it is a reference measuring point

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    You cannot create measurement documents for a reference measuring point.

    The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.

    System Response

    How to fix this error?

    Enter a measuring point.

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message IR504 - Measuring point &1 is not available; it is a reference measuring point ?

    The SAP error message IR504 indicates that the measuring point you are trying to access or use is not available because it is a reference measuring point. This typically occurs in the context of SAP's Plant Maintenance (PM) or Utilities Management modules, where measuring points are used to track consumption or performance metrics.

    Cause:

    1. Reference Measuring Point: The measuring point you are trying to use is defined as a reference measuring point. Reference measuring points are typically used for comparison or as a template and are not intended for direct measurement entries.
    2. Incorrect Configuration: The measuring point may not be properly configured in the system, or it may not be assigned to the correct object or location.
    3.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ary permissions to access or modify the measuring point.
    4. Inactive Measuring Point: The measuring point may be inactive or not set up correctly in the system.

    Solution:

    1. Check Measuring Point Configuration:

      • Go to the measuring point configuration in SAP and verify if the measuring point is indeed set as a reference measuring point. If it should not be, you may need to change its configuration.
      • Use transaction code IK01 to create or IK02 to change measuring points and check the settings.
    2. Use a Different Measuring Point:

      • If the measuring point is intended to be a reference, you may need to use a different measuring point that is not a reference for your operations.
